I opened my pool got it cleaned up and clear, and tested using TF test kit. This is where I need some help. I'm a little confused. My test findings follow:
FC=1
CC=.5
TC=1.5
pH=7.2
T/A=80
CYA=100
Water temp=75 F
I plugged all the numbers into the calculator and was told that I need to add 60% new water. Is this the only way to lower my CYA & how important is it that this is done?
I have 28,000 gal in ground pool with a center drain and one skimmer. I am have a pool frog set up using pool frog bac pac & pool frog in mineral pac. I have a cartridge filter using 4 filters.
If I lower the water level 60% and add new water do I wait until I do this to make all my chemical adjustments or do I adjust it now?
The pool frog setup came with the pool. Is it a bad idea to use it?
